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

The purpose of this study is to learn about dacomitinib for the possible treatment of lung cancer which has spread to other parts of the body.

This study is seeking participants who:

* have lung cancer that has reached at least the brain.
* have a type of gene called epidermoid growth factor receptor. A gene is a part of your DNA that has instructions for making things your body needs to work.
* have not received any treatment before.

All participants in this study will receive dacomitnib 1 time a day. Dacomitinib is a tablet that is taken by mouth at home. They can continue to take dacomitnib until their cancer is no longer responding. The study will look at the experiences of people receiving the study medicine. This will help to see if the study medicine is safe and effective.

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

* at least 18 years old
* confirmed diagnosis of EGFR mutation-positive NSCLC
* at least one measurable intracranial metastasis
* ECOG-PS of 0, 1 or 2
* dacomitinib as first-line treatment for advanced NSCLC
* Evidence of a personally signed and dated informed consent document (ICD)

Exclusion Criteria

* any anti-cancer systemic treatment within 12 months prior to index date
* currently on active investigational drug(s) treatment in other clinical studies (Phase 1-4) within 2 weeks before the current study begins and/or during study participation.
